Romania overtakes Poland as worst EU country for LGBTQ+ people
Romania has overtaken Poland as the worst country in the EU for LGBTQ+ people, according to a ranking published by the Brussels-based non-governmental organization ILGA-Europe. Romanian charged over arson attacks on properties connected to British prime minister
Romanian national Stanislav Carpiuc, 26, from Romford, was charged with conspiracy to commit arson with intent to endanger life following the fires in north London. Gabriela Stănică joins Carrefour Romania’s executive committee
Carrefour Romania has appointed Gabriela Stănică to its executive committee, effective June 1, 2025. She is serving as Chief Information Officer for Digital and AI. With over two decades of experience in the IT sector, Stănică joined Carrefour Romania in October 2020. Romania enacts law allowing military to down unauthorized drones
Romania has officially enacted a law allowing its armed forces to shoot down unauthorized drones entering national airspace, following a decree signed by interim president Ilie Bolojan on Monday, May 19. US Ambassador Kathleen Kavalec retires, Michael Dickerson named acting head of mission in Bucharest
The US Embassy in Bucharest announced the retirement of Ambassador Kathleen Kavalec on Tuesday, May 20.
